KVM: sefltests: Use CPUID_* instead of X86_FEATURE_* for one-off usage



Rename X86_FEATURE_* macros to CPUID_* in various tests to free up the
X86_FEATURE_* names for KVM-Unit-Tests style CPUID automagic where the
function, leaf, register, and bit for the feature is embedded in its
macro value.

No functional change intended.
